Beyond Scope One & 2 : Mastering Scope 3 Emissions Reporting
While managing Scope 1 and Scope 2 footprints represents a significant first step for many businesses, comprehensively quantifying climate responsibility requires attention on Scope Three emissions . These indirect emissions , originating from the supply chain and client use, often represent the largest portion of a business's climate effect. Successful Scope Three reporting involves building robust data collection procedures, partnering with vendors , and employing recognized guidelines.
- Pinpoint relevant Scope 3 sources.
- Establish mechanisms for data acquisition .
- Partner with suppliers to collect figures.
- Substantiate disclosed figures by reviews.
